quote:
Originally posted by Sigman940:
Sig Sauer P239 357 7RD magazine W/8 WITNESS HOLES SKU: 239-357-7RD/8

Any chance these mags will work in the P239 .40 S&W version? Also curious the manufacturer origin? Thanks in advance.

The way I understand the 239 mags...You can use the .40 mags for .357 and .40 rounds. The .357 mags are necked down to fit the shape of the .357 round, and won't accept .40 rounds.

quote:
Originally posted by lordhamster:
quote:
Originally posted by dwd1985:
Question on the Swiss Police used SP2009's. IT says imported from Switzerland, so are they Swiss made? Or German made? Also, the pic doesn't seem to show a rail on it, I didnt know they ever made the SigPros without rails?


Will these SP2009s fit into SP2020 Holsters?


These are Swiss Made. The SP2009 does have a proprietary rail fitted into the frame. It just looks like there isn't one.

These will fit in SP2022 holsters.
